6 Chicken Breast
1 Bottle Teriyaki sauce
1 head lettuce
romaine lettuce
6-8 green onions -chopped
1/4 C. slivered almonds
1 can sliced water chestnuts (I do not add these)
1/2 pkg won ton skins
1 1/2 C. sprouts
whatever else you like... tomatoes, pea pods, cauliflower, ect...
Dressing:
3/4 C. salad oil
1 T. sesame oil
1/2 rice vinegar
1/3 C. sugar
2 tsp. salt
1 tsp. pepper
Place chicken in a baking dish with the teriyaki sauce and bake at 300* for 1 hour, turning once. Cool and dice. Place back in the sauce for a few hours. Cut stack of won ton skins into 4 strips. Separate and fry in hot oil until golden brown. Drain on paper towels. Set aside. When ready to serve, put lettuce in large bowl and top with chicken and other remaining ingredients. Toss with dressing.
Dressing: combine all ingredients and refrigerate several hours.
